BREAKING DeepSeek just let the world know they make $200M/yr at 500%+ profit margin.
Revenue (/day): $562k
Cost (/day): $87k
Revenue (/yr): ~$205M
This is all while charging $2.19/M tokens on R1, ~25x less than OpenAI o1.
If this was in the US, this would be a >$10B company. https://t.co/haiYuEwxVj
To make $1M, you need:
- $50M in revenue with a grocery store
- $20M in revenue with a restaurant
- $10M in revenue with an e-commerce brand
- $5M in revenue with a real estate agency
- $3M in revenue with a mobile gaming app
- $1.2M in revenue with a SaaS
Revenue ≠ Profit
